#include <cstdlib>

rand( ); - "pseudo" random number

randomNumber = rand( )%10; // generate random number 0 thru 9

srand( int seed ); - seed the random number

remember...calling a library function

int ranNum;ranNum = rand( ) %2; // random one or

zero

The result of the library function is placed into ranNum. The rand()%2 function returns a random 0 or 1 as a “service”.

two problems with rand( )

1. random numbers are the same every time you run it (the algorithm starts at a consistent place)

2. rand( )%2 gives equally spaced 0s and 1s (not random for these low numbers) on old computers (32 bit)

#include <ctime>• time( 0 ); - returns the number of seconds

since Jan 1 1970. I have no idea why. But, not an integer, some mutant "time" string…

• so:#include <ctime>#include <cstdlib>

srand ( (int) time(0) ); // seed random number generator with time

actually, time(0) is a "structure"

• a structure, or "struct" in C++, is a meta-variable, that contains many variables… one main, and a number of auxiliary values

• the "time" struct contains the number of seconds (its main value), but also month, day, date and year which we can access when we get good at this
